What Does Error 3E Mean?

The Samsung Dishwasher error code 3E signifies a high-temperature water supply issue, typically occurring when incoming water exceeds approximately 80°C. This error interrupts the wash cycle and may cause unusual noises during operation. To resolve this, check the water supply temperature and adjust your home water heater if necessary. If the issue persists, further investigation of the temperature sensor may be required.

Common Symptoms:

  • Error code “3E” appears on the dishwasher display
  • Cycle stops or does not start when water supply is too hot
  • Dishwasher fails to progress past initial wash stages

Possible Causes

  • Incoming water temperature above the dishwasher’s allowable threshold (high)
  • Faulty temperature sensor or misreading of water temperature (medium)

How to Fix Error 3E

DIY Fix Check and adjust water supply temperature

  1. Turn off the dishwasher and ensure the hot water supply valve is open to normal household setting.
  2. Adjust your home water heater thermostat to a lower setting.
  3. Run the dishwasher again to see if the error clears.

Technician Only Inspect temperature sensor and control circuitry

  1. Measure incoming water temperature at the dishwasher inlet to confirm it is within specification.
  2. Test the dishwasher’s internal temperature sensor (thermistor) for correct resistance and response.
  3. Check wiring connections between the temperature sensor and control board for continuity.
  4. Replace defective temperature sensor or repair wiring as needed.

Parts needed: Temperature sensor (thermistor), Control board connectors/wiring

🛑 When to Call a Pro:
  • If lowering water temperature does not clear the error and the dishwasher repeatedly displays 3E.
  • If internal temperature sensor diagnostics show faults.
  • If error appears alongside other fault codes indicating multiple failures.
